Effect of the phase space factor in the breakup of composite particles

The need to include the phase space factor in the analysis of ..cap alpha.. breakup spectra according to Fermi's Golden Rule is indicated. The importance of the number of particles present in the final state is exemplified by a model calculation for proton, deuteron, and triton spectra produced by the breakup of 160 MeV alphas on zirconium.
